Definition
  1. Noun:
    • An instrument that indicates the speed of an aircraft relative to the speed of sound: A machmeter is a flight instrument that displays the aircraft's Mach number, which is the ratio of the aircraft's true airspeed to the local speed of sound.

Variants and Related Words
  • Mach number (n): The dimensionless quantity representing the ratio of speed to the speed of sound, which the machmeter displays.
    • A Mach number of 1.0 indicates the aircraft is traveling at the speed of sound.
Synonyms
  • Airspeed indicator (contextual): While a standard airspeed indicator shows indicated airspeed, a machmeter is a specialized type for showing Mach number. They are related but not perfect synonyms.
Notes
  • The word is a compound noun formed from "Mach" (named after physicist Ernst Mach) and "meter" (a measuring instrument). It refers specifically to the measuring device itself.
